Pods Coffee Machine

A pods coffee machine is likely to be the best option when convenience is important to you. They use premeasured and sealed coffee pods in order to make rich coffee in a matter of seconds.

The capsule casings are usually made of aluminum and plastic, which can be recycled separately but are an environmental disaster when combined however many companies are developing compostable alternatives.

One of the advantages of a pod coffee machine is that it's easier to maintain than a bean to cup or french press model. The machine has fewer parts, and cleaning is easier. There is also no need to grind the beans or crush the beans.

Not all pods are compatible with every coffee machine. The best way to find out which ones will work with yours is by checking the manual. Most manufacturers will list the brands and sizes of the pods that work with their models.

Pod coffee machines are convenient however, they require regular descalement and replacement of the water tank. If you don't do this then your machine will eventually become blocked and produce less than optimal coffee. Pod machines require less maintenance compared to bean-to-cup machines. They do require to be cleaned frequently. The most frequent issue is that they create a layer of limescale or calcium on their internal parts. This can alter the taste of your coffee, and also damage the machine. Luckily, a lot of pod coffee machines come with indicator lights to warn you when it's time to descale.
